Iga Swiatek’s 25th birthday turned bitter as Ukrainian 15th seed Marta Kostyuk defeated her 7-5, 6-1 in the French Open Round of 16.
The former champion’s pursuit of a fifth Roland Garros title ended abruptly in a straight-set shocker.
Both players traded early breaks, but Kostyuk held firm in the 11th game and sealed the first set with a stunning backhand crosscourt winner.
